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82594789737 40 6010277266 264776018
2031670681 9930
2031670681 9930
1074 8581149001 236508491
All about undefined
Interested in learning more?
2031670681 9930
1074 8581149001 236508491
See more
3907945 59093206866 078161
92382 27843 0430606 1047055
See more
766150 01411290980 14400372
23187 004873 30834 94565902505
See more